Understanding the Operational Landscape in Research & Evaluation

When delving into operations in Research & Evaluation, it's crucial to recognize several important elements that define the scope of operation. At the core, R&E involves systemically assessing the design, implementation, and outcomes of various projects supported by funding initiatives. This includes measuring progress against established benchmarks, analyzing data, and deriving insights that can influence future research directions and policy-making.

The operational framework is not merely a set of guidelines; it encompasses a tightly woven structure involving diverse activities that must align to achieve desired outcomes. For instance, implementing a robust evaluation design is a requisite that facilitates the systematic collection of data, which informs how well a particular initiative meets its goals.

One concrete regulation that significantly impacts operations is adherence to the standards set by the NSF for any funded projects. These standards dictate the methodologies for collecting, analyzing, and reporting data, ensuring a level of consistency and quality across the research environment. Projects under this funding umbrella must comply with these requirements, which guide researchers in maintaining integrity and rigor in their evaluation processes.

Delivery Challenges in Research & Evaluation

Despite best efforts in planning and execution, R&E faces unique delivery challenges that can impact the efficacy of the research process. A significant challenge is data access and interoperability among different research systems. Often, researchers struggle with fragmented data systems that do not easily communicate with one another, resulting in inefficiencies and potential data quality issues. The lack of a unified platform means researchers must invest additional time and resources in data management practices to ensure accurate reporting, which can lead to delays in project timelines.

Another delivery constraint is the continuous need for interdisciplinary collaboration. R&E often requires participation from a varied array of experts, including statisticians, researchers from other fields, and practitioners. However, coordinating among these diverse groups can introduce complexities in communication and goal alignment, ultimately affecting project outcomes. Effective operations must emphasize establishing clear communication channels and creating environments conducive to collaboration.

Staffing Needs in the Research & Evaluation Sector

The success of operations within R&E heavily relies on having well-trained personnel who are equipped to navigate the complexities associated with evaluations. A multidisciplinary team is essential; members may include data analysts, field researchers, project managers, and subject matter experts who can provide insights relevant to particular research areas. Each role contributes uniquely to the research process, and having a team that is both adequately staffed and skilled can dramatically enhance output.

Beyond hiring qualified personnel, ongoing professional development is imperative. As technology and methodologies evolve, continuous education and training opportunities must be prioritized to ensure that staff members remain at the forefront of innovative practices in research and evaluation. This investment in human capital not only boosts staff morale but also ensures quality outputs that align with industry standards.

Compliance and Risk Management in Research & Evaluation

Compliance with federal regulations and standards is non-negotiable in the R&E space. Researchers must be vigilant to avoid compliance traps, which can arise from misinterpretation of funder guidelines or failing to address ethical considerations in research and data handling. Not adhering to these regulations can result in funding being revoked or, in severe cases, legal ramifications. Organizations must develop robust compliance frameworks that guide their operations and uphold the integrity of their research endeavors.

Equally important is understanding what types of projects are not funded within this sector. Many federal grants, including those from the NSF, do not support projects that primarily aim to generate profit or benefit a single entity without broader societal impacts. Thus, applicants must carefully craft proposals that clearly articulate their objectives and demonstrate alignment with grant priorities.

Key Performance Indicators (KPIs) in Research & Evaluation

For successful operations in R&E, identifying the right KPIs is crucial. Organizations should focus on metrics that assess the efficacy and impact of their research initiatives. Common KPIs include:

  • Implementation Success Rate: Measures how well the research processes adhere to planned methodologies.
  • Data Quality Ratings: Assessing the integrity and reliability of collected data.
  • Engagement Levels with Stakeholders: Analyzing participation rates from intended audiences.
  • Outcome Achievement Rates: Evaluating whether research objectives were met based on established benchmarks.

Additionally, reporting requirements mandate that R&E projects provide transparent documentation of their progress and findings. Regular updates to funders not only reinforce accountability but also highlight the project's alignment with intended goals. Proposals should outline how the research will be documented and the frequency of reports to ensure funding continuity.
